CVE-2006-5212: Medium severity trend micro officescan vulnerability
Trend Micro OfficeScan 6.0 in Client/Server/Messaging (CSM) Suite for SMB 2.0 before 6.0.0.1385, and OfficeScan Corporate Edition (OSCE) 6.5 before 6.5.0.1418, 7.0 before 7.0.0.1257, and 7.3 before 7.3.0.1053 allow remote attackers to delete files via a modified filename parameter in a certain HTTP request that invokes the OfficeScan CGI program.

What is the severity of CVE-2006-5212?
CVE-2006-5212 has a medium severity level, allowing remote attackers to delete files.
How do I fix CVE-2006-5212?
To fix CVE-2006-5212, update Trend Micro OfficeScan to the latest version specified in the vendor's security patches.
Which versions are affected by CVE-2006-5212?
CVE-2006-5212 affects Trend Micro OfficeScan 6.0, Corporate Edition 6.5, 7.0, and 7.3 before specific patch levels.
What type of attack does CVE-2006-5212 facilitate?
CVE-2006-5212 facilitates remote file deletion attacks via a modified filename parameter in an HTTP request.
Is my system vulnerable to CVE-2006-5212?
If you are using an affected version of Trend Micro OfficeScan without the necessary updates, your system is vulnerable to CVE-2006-5212.
